苹果CMS(内容管理系统)的多服务器负载均衡配置详解,苹果CMS的多服务器负载均衡是一种确保网站在高流量情况下保持高效运行的关键技术,通过将访问流量分配到多个服务器上,可以有效避免单一服务器的瓶颈,提高网站的响应速度和稳定性,本文将详细阐述如何配置苹果CMS以支持多服务器负载均衡,包括硬件负载均衡器、软件负载均衡算法以及监控和故障转移等方面的策略,通过合理的负载均衡配置,苹果CMS能够轻松应对大流量的挑战,确保网站的高可用性和用户体验。
随着互联网的快速发展,越来越多的网站和企业选择使用苹果Content Management System (CMS)来构建和管理自己的网站,随着网站的访问量和数据量的增长,单台服务器可能无法满足高并发和高流量的需求,实现苹果CMS的多服务器负载均衡配置成为了确保网站稳定性和性能的关键,本文将详细介绍苹果CMS多服务器负载均衡配置的实现方法,帮助读者解决高并发和大数据量带来的挑战。
苹果CMS概述
苹果CMS是一款开源的内容管理系统,它具有易用、灵活、可扩展等特点,适用于各种规模的网站和应用,通过苹果CMS,网站管理员可以轻松地创建、编辑和管理网站内容,同时支持多种插件和扩展,以满足个性化的需求。
多服务器负载均衡的重要性
在多服务器环境下,负载均衡能够有效地将访问流量分配到多个服务器上,避免单点故障,提高网站的可用性和稳定性,通过负载均衡,可以实现以下目标:
-
提高网站访问速度:通过将请求分发到多个服务器,减少单个服务器的压力,提高页面加载速度。
-
增强系统的可靠性:当某个服务器出现故障时,负载均衡器可以将请求自动切换到其他正常工作的服务器上,保证网站的正常运行。
-
扩展性强:通过增加服务器数量,可以轻松应对网站访问量和数据量的增长。
苹果CMS多服务器负载均衡配置步骤
-
选择负载均衡器:选择一个高性能、高可靠性的负载均衡器,如Nginx、HAProxy等。
-
配置负载均衡算法:根据实际需求选择合适的负载均衡算法,如轮询、加权轮询、最少连接等。
-
添加服务器列表:在负载均衡器中添加苹果CMS服务器的IP地址和端口信息。
-
设置健康检查:定期检查苹果CMS服务器的健康状态,自动剔除故障节点。
-
配置虚拟主机:为每个苹果CMS服务器设置独立的虚拟主机,以便在负载均衡器中进行请求分发。
-
重启负载均衡器:完成配置后,重启负载均衡器以使配置生效。
注意事项
-
数据同步:在多服务器环境下,确保苹果CMS的数据能够在各个服务器之间实时同步,避免数据不一致的问题。
-
安全性:配置负载均衡器时,要确保只有合法的访问请求能够通过负载均衡器进入苹果CMS系统。
-
监控和报警:建立完善的监控机制,实时监控苹果CMS服务器的运行状态,并在出现异常时及时报警。
苹果CMS多服务器负载均衡配置是提高网站性能和稳定性的重要手段,通过合理地选择和配置负载均衡器及相关参数,可以有效地应对高并发和大数据量带来的挑战,确保苹果CMS网站的正常运行和良好用户体验。